Senior Global Compensation & Benefits Specialist Our client is a prestigious global brand and industry leader partnering with Re:work to hire a Senior Global Compensation & Benefits Specialist. This is a multi-agency assignment, with another recruitment agency supporting the search.
Role Summary
This senior Compensation & Benefits role offers the chance to work across multiple regions, supporting the delivery of global pay structures, bonus schemes, and benefits programs while managing day-to-day operational processes. You’ll contribute to shaping C&B strategies, optimising systems, and enhancing the employee experience in a growing international business.
The role is suited to an experienced compensation and benefits professional who is systems-focused, analytical, and energised by balancing strategic initiatives with operational delivery in a dynamic, evolving environment.
About the Company & HR Department
Our client is a well-established global organisation experiencing significant growth and investment in HR infrastructure, including optimising global compensation and benefits processes and systems. The team operates collaboratively across projects while maintaining ownership of their core areas, ensuring seamless delivery of compensation and benefits programs to employees worldwide.
What You'll Be Doing
Contribute to the implementation and administration of global compensation and benefits strategies
Analyse market pay and benefits trends to inform internal decisions
Coordinate pay and bonus processes, providing insights to HR and business partners
Ensure compensation and benefits records are accurate and up to date across all regions
Work with external vendors and brokers to maintain and improve benefits programs
Provide input on compensation and benefits considerations for hiring and internal moves
Spot process improvements and help streamline compensation and benefits operations
Support global HR initiatives and change programs as required
What We're Looking For
5+ years’ experience in compensation and benefits, ideally in a global context
Strong understanding of HRIS systems, pay structures, benefits programs, and market benchmarking
Proven experience managing pay and bonus cycles, benefits renewals, and vendor relationships
Excellent analytical skills, advanced Excel proficiency, and attention to detail
Ideally from financial services, large-scale organisations, or similar structured environments
Strong communication and stakeholder management skills
What's On Offer
Salary: €75,000-€85,000 with some flexibility for exceptional candidates with extensive Comp & Bens experience gained within a global setting.
Location: Dublin 2
Contract: Permanent, full-time position
Bonus opportunity
Onsite gym
How They Work
This role is based in the Dublin head office and requires full-time onsite presence (5 days per week) during the first 6 months/probationary period. Following successful completion of probation, the position moves to a hybrid model: three days onsite and two days working from home each week.
The HR team operates collaboratively, with in-person time focused on complex projects, key stakeholder engagement, and driving global C&B initiatives.
